Restaurant Site Selection Considerations for Pinal County, Arizona

Poor site selection stands as a critical factor contributing to the failure of restaurants in Pinal County, Arizona. Neglecting the significance of site selection can have detrimental consequences that ultimately lead to a restaurant going out of business.

Firstly, selecting a location with inadequate foot traffic can severely hinder a restaurant's chances of success. If a restaurant is situated in an area with low visibility or limited customer flow, it will struggle to attract a sufficient number of patrons. Insufficient foot traffic directly impacts customer acquisition and can result in reduced revenue and profitability, making it difficult for the restaurant to sustain its operations.

Secondly, poor site selection may lead to intense competition and market saturation. Pinal County, Arizona, with its diverse culinary landscape, demands careful consideration of existing competitors. Choosing a site in close proximity to well-established, popular restaurants without offering a unique value proposition can dilute the customer base and lead to fierce competition. In such scenarios, the restaurant may struggle to differentiate itself, resulting in decreased market share and potential failure.

Thirdly, ignoring the demographics and preferences of the local population can prove detrimental. Understanding the target market's characteristics, such as age, income levels, and cultural preferences, is crucial for tailoring the restaurant's offerings and ambiance. Failure to align with the preferences and demands of the local population may result in a lack of customer interest and loyalty, leading to declining patronage and eventual closure.

Lastly, disregarding essential infrastructure factors can contribute to a restaurant's downfall. Factors such as parking availability, accessibility to public transportation, and proximity to major attractions or residential areas significantly impact customer convenience. If a site lacks adequate parking or is challenging to reach, potential diners may choose more accessible alternatives, resulting in lost business opportunities.

In conclusion, poor site selection acts as a critical failure factor for restaurants in Pinal County, Arizona. It diminishes visibility, exposes the business to intense competition, disregards the preferences of the local population, and neglects crucial infrastructure considerations. To avoid the risks associated with poor site selection, thorough research, data analysis, and a deep understanding of the target market are necessary to identify a prime location that will maximize the restaurant's chances of success and sustainability.
